 intensity (n) 強烈; 強度
字源: in – in + -tens- to stretch
英解: great energy of emotion, thought, or activity
例句: His speech is full of intensity.
同義字: strength

 constrain (v) 強迫, 限制; 抑制
字源: con – together + -strain- to draw tight
英解: to prevent; force people to act in a particular way and prevent them from doing what they want to
例句: A mother constrains her little kids all the time.
同義字: compel, inhibit, confine, restrain

 heir (n) 繼承人
字源: -heres- to leave behind
英解: the person who has the right to inherit someone’s money, property, or title after someone dies
例句: The prince is heir to the king.
同義字: inheritor

 scatter (v) 使消散;使分散
字源: -sked- to cut
英解: irregularly throw or drop a lot of things so that they are spread all over the area
例句: This boy’s room is terrible; everything is scattered on the floor.
同義字: disperse, dissipate, dispel, sprinkle

 wield (v) 揮舞(劍等);使用(工具等), 行使(權力);施加(影響)
字源: -valere- strong
英解: to handle and use
例句: The president wields his power to dismiss the Congress.
同義字: handle, exert

         tax (n,v) 負擔;壓力
字源: -tact- touch, task
英解: a heavy demand, burden, strain
例句: The college entrance test is really a tax on all students.
同義字: strain

        strain (n,v) 負擔;沈重壓力

字源: -str- stretch

英解: pressure, stress

例句: Many engineers in the computer industry suffer from strain.

同義字: tax, stress, pressure, tension

   jettison (v) (船舶等在遇難時為減輕負載而)投棄(貨物)
字源: -jet, ject- throw

英解: intentionally get rid of something

例句: A male bluegill fish jettisons a cloud of sperm.

同義字: discharge

  discharge (v) 排出(液體,氣體等), 釋放; (貨物等), 射出
字源: dis- away from + -char- car

英解: send something out

例句: One female insect may discharge as many as 400 million eggs.

同義字: jettison, release
